失眠网,内容丰富有趣,生活中的好帮手!
失眠网 > 使用MySQL模拟KV数据库的实现方法详解 mysql 多线程备份

使用MySQL模拟KV数据库的实现方法详解 mysql 多线程备份

时间:2019-07-12 19:09:44

相关推荐

使用MySQL模拟KV数据库的实现方法详解 mysql 多线程备份

1. 创建数据库

首先,大家需要创建一个MySQL数据库来存储键值对数据。可以使用以下命令创建一个名为“kvdb”的数据库:

CREATE DATABASE kvdb;

2. 创建数据表

接下来,大家需要创建一个数据表来存储键值对数据。可以使用以下命令创建一个名为“kvtable”的数据表:

CREATE TABLE kvtable (

id INT(11) NOT NULL AUTO_INCREMENT,

`key` VARCHAR(255) NOT NULL,

`value` TEXT NOT NULL,

PRIMARY KEY (id),

UNIQUE KEY `key` (`key`)

在这个数据表中,大家定义了三个字段:id、key和value。其中,id是自增长的主键,key和value分别用来存储键和值。此外,大家还为key字段创建了一个唯一索引,以保证每个键都是唯一的。

3. 插入数据

现在,大家可以向数据表中插入数据了。可以使用以下命令插入一条键值对数据:

ame’);

ame”的数据。

4. 查询数据

查询数据是使用KV数据库最常见的操作之一。可以使用以下命令查询指定键的值:

ame’;

ame”。

5. 更新数据

如果需要更新一个键的值,可以使用以下命令:

ame’;

ame”。

6. 删除数据

如果需要删除一个键值对数据,可以使用以下命令:

ame’;

ame”的数据。

本文介绍了如何使用MySQL模拟KV数据库的实现方法。通过创建一个数据表来存储键值对数据,并使用SQL语句进行插入、查询、更新和删除操作,可以实现一个简单的KV数据库。当然,实际的KV数据库还需要更多的功能和优化,但这个实现方法可以作为一个入门级别的实现参考。

如果觉得《使用MySQL模拟KV数据库的实现方法详解 mysql 多线程备份》对你有帮助,请点赞、收藏,并留下你的观点哦!

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。